    Overview What you will learnThrough rigorous review of the scientific literature, graduate students are expected to gain advanced knowledge of clinical and scientific studies involving dental implants and related procedures required to regenerate oral and craniofacial tissues. These studies are intended to form the fundamental basis to pursue evidence-based practice for clinicians, as well as conduct scientific studies for clinical researchers. This Biomedical Implants and Tissue Engineering MSc program offered at University of Southern California is suitable for those, who are interested to gain expertise in dental implant therapeutics and regenerative sciences. In addition to the didactic courses and gaining comprehensive understanding with relevant scientific literature, graduate students are required to design and complete a scientific research project, under the supervision of an academic committee, composed of mentors with relevant expertise. The resulting data from the scientific study is expected to be prepared in manuscript format and submitted for publication in a peer-reviewed journal. The Biomedical Implants and Tissue Engineering MS program at University of Southern California is 6 trimesters (24 months) in length.     The Biomedical Implants and Tissue Engineering MSc program offered at University of Southern California is an intense academic program designed to enhance the knowledge and critical thinking skills of graduate students interested in biological and clinical aspects of osseointegration and clinical applications of tissue engineering sciences.

    Requirements

    Other Requirements

    • 1 : All applicants must be enrolled in Ostrow’s Periodontology Program.All applicants to the BITE MS program must have earned a dental degree (DDS, DMD, BDS or equivalent) by the time of matriculation.For U.S. applicants, the dental degree must be earned at an American Dental Association (ADA)-accredited university, located in the United States.For international applicants, the dental degree should be conferred by an institution accredited by the country’s Ministry of Education or equivalent. The transcripts must be submitted with official translation, directly by the school itself or by a professional, certified translator.
